    The Progeny handheld Raman analyzer from Rigaku Raman Technologies (Burlington, MA) has a miniature volume phase grating (VPG)-based 1064 nm optical engine to minimize fluorescence interference in pharmaceutical applications. Features include a 512-pixel indium gallium arsenide (InGaAs) detector, ultrafast quad-core processor, and a wavelets-based spectral match algorithm.
